wysiwyg is hand rolling its own get_libraries function, so the above patches will not work for wysiwyg when it's looking for libraries if the libraries are located in a base profile (not the current top level install profile).


Patch is attached. Uses libraries module functions (which are the ones patched above), if they are available, to get all available libraries.

Rolling own library was a big problem. Have not yet tested this patch but it is critical to support growing distro base.

I can confirm the patch in #1 works! Thanks.

